AUGUSTA, Ga. -- A 69-year-old Augusta man is now half a million dollars richer after winning an instant game from the Georgia Lottery.
Samuel Testino won the top prize in the $500,000 Green game. Testino bought his ticket at the DLS Gas Station on Mike Padgett Highway.
He says he bought four tickets and was shocked when he scratched off the top prize.
"And I couldn't believe it. So what I did, I came back up and I said, 'I gotta have somebody to verify this.' So I asked the girl that sold me the ticket, I held it in front of her and I said, 'Is this real? Did I really win?' and she said, 'Yes, you've won half a million dollars,'" Testino said.
The father of five won the money on his youngest son's birthday.
Testino says he plans on retiring, playing a lot of golf and getting rid of all his debt.
Profits from the Georgia Lottery go to educational programs throughout the state, including the HOPE Scholarship Program and Georgia's Pre-K Program.
